Integrated Weather and Climate Services in Support of Net Zero Energy Transition (WMO-No. 1312)

The document is an update of the Global Framework for Climate Services (GFCS) “Energy Exemplar” and was compiled under the aegis of the WMO Study Group for Integrated Energy Services (SG-ENE ), part of the Commission for weather, climate, water and related environmental services and applications (SERCOM), with contributions from some of the leading experts in the field. The document provides the background and guidelines required to strengthen the development, and enable a widespread uptake, of integrated Weather & Climate Services (W&CSs) for the Energy sector needed to accelerate the transition towards net zero emissions.

Guidance on Measuring, Modelling and Monitoring the Canopy Layer Urban Heat Island (CL‑UHI) (WMO-No. 1292)

The guidance provides an overview of and recommendations for measuring, modelling and monitoring the Canopy Layer urban heat island, which is based on temperature information at about 1.5 m above ground. Canopy Layer urban heat island information is one component of the integrated urban hydro-meteorological, climate and environmental services for citizens. These services may be provided directly by National Meteorological and Hydrometeorological Service (NMHS) operations, in cooperation with stakeholders or partners, or indirectly through stakeholders or partners in cities, public and private agencies.

Survey on the Status of Human Resources in National Meteorological and Hydrological Services: Staff, Competencies and Qualifications (WMO-No. 1305)

The WMO’s seventh survey on the status of human resources in National Meteorological and Hydrological Services (NMHSs), conducted from 2021 to 2022, reiterated the previous survey’s investigation of staffing patterns, and added inquiry concerning qualifications and competencies. The report’s introduction elucidates survey administration and major survey findings. The main body of the report presents detailed survey results in two parts: Staffing (numbers of staff by gender, professional category, attainment of university degree, age category, and staffing trends); and Capacity Development (numbers of experts needing trained, fellowship priorities, training priority areas, completion rates for the BIP-M frameworks, and implementation and assessment rates concerning the sixteen WMO competency standards. Survey results are presented for the global respondent group, as well as for each of the six WMO Regions. The report sheds particular light on progress in gender equity and needed emphasis on climate services and knowledge transfer.

TCP, 30. Regional Association IV – Hurricane Operational Plan for North America, Central America and the Caribbean (WMO-No. 1163), TCP-30
The regional activities under the WMO Tropical Cyclone Programme consist mainly of the programmes pursued by groups of countries acting in concert to improve their warning systems. In Region IV (North America, Central America and the Caribbean) there is a long history of collective action specifically designed to protect people and property from the severe tropical cyclones which are called hurricanes in the Region. State of Global Water Resources 2021 (WMO-No. 1308)
As a first edition of the annual State of Global Water Resources, this report shows how maps and a graphical summary of streamflow and TWS in river basins worldwide could look in regular reports on global water resources. These maps are based on modelled data (and validated with observed data to the extent possible) and remotely sensed information from the NASA GRACE mission for TWS. Modelled data was used to achieve maximum geographical coverage.
